**Q: What unlocks the canary gating override for Pellbright deploys?**

A: Canaries promote automatically when error rate stays under 0.5% for 30 minutes across two regions. If the gate wedges during an incident, the override vault on the Quillhaven controller must be opened manually. The on-call lead opens it with the recovery passphrase recorded just below this answer.

vault phrase of yagag-kadup = belael-druius-rusax-kelox

### Step 4: Enable the shared connection pool

With the Harrowgate service now on the pooled driver, each worker no longer opens its own connections; all traffic routes through the central pool. Verify that idle timeouts are shorter than the database's own cutoff, otherwise reaped connections surface as intermittent errors. Once verified, update the service to start with the pool parameters below.

deployment values, faduf-tawep:
SORDOR_LOG_LEVEL=error
SORDOR_METRICS_HOST=metrics.sordor.nelvrolabs.internal
SORDOR_POOL_SIZE=4

## Formula sandbox tuning

User-supplied formulas in Gridmoor execute inside a restricted interpreter with hard ceilings on time, memory, and call depth. Reviewers should confirm any change to these ceilings is justified in the PR description, since raising them widens the abuse surface. Defaults were chosen from production traces. The current limits are as follows.

limits module of tafog-fawip:
WEIGHTS = {
    "julix": 57,
    "lamys": 992,
    "kasvan": 209,
    "quenok": 750,
    "alddor": 259,
    "oliath": 1009,
    "wenix": 815,
}

The Lanternseed extraction script pulls translatable strings from all frontend packages and writes them to the shared catalog. Run it before every release cut; missed runs are the most common cause of untranslated strings shipping to the Fernmark locale builds. It takes about four minutes and is idempotent. Step-by-step instructions and the flag reference are on the internal page below.

operations page: https://jenkins.zemvarcloud.local/job/merge_requests/repo/build/73930b4b30f0a8ed